企业🤖AI Agent构建引擎,智能编排和调试,一键部署,支持私有化部署方案 广告
接着我们要先创建第一个控制器,要不然点击顶部的“门户”菜单会提示错误。 在`cms`目录下的`admin`目录创建`Index.php`控制器 ~~~ <?php namespace app\cms\admin; use app\admin\controller\Admin; class Index extends Admin { // 文章列表 public function index() { dump('文章列表'); } } ~~~ 这时候点击顶部导航的“门户”,页面会出现“文章列表,说明到目前为止我们的操作都是正确的,接下来我们让页面丰富一些。 DolphinPHP为大家提供了一系列强大、快速、易用的页面构造器,可以很方便的制作页面,这个我们在“快速构建器”章节会详细说明,这里先示范一下,不知道怎么用没关系,相信看完本文档,您会感受到DolphinPHP的魅力所在。 我们把上面的代码改一下 ~~~ <?php namespace app\cms\admin; use app\admin\controller\Admin; use app\common\builder\ZBuilder; // 引入ZBuilder class Index extends Admin { // 文章列表 public function index() { // 使用ZBuilder快速创建数据表格 return ZBuilder::make('table')->fetch(); } } ~~~ 刷新一下,页面就出来了,是不是很简单?当然,目前还没有任何数据。 ![](https://box.kancloud.cn/2c9cd70041c3e572566a766ca1061314_1915x565.png)